Ryanair pilots go on strike accross Europe

Description

Tens of thousands of passengers were hit by transport chaos on Friday as Ryanair pilots across Europe went on a coordinated 24-hour strike to push their demands for better pay and conditions at the peak of the busy summer season. IMAGES of pilots at Charleroi Airport

  • Ryanair Pilots Forced to Diverted Flight After Brawl Breaks Out in Plane

    Mobile phone video provided courtesy of Tommy Engerer captures the moment as a fight breaks out on a Ryanair flight travelling from Brussels to Malta on Thursday, forcing the plane to land in Pisa, Italy. For reasons that are still unknown, four men began assaulting each other suddenly as flight service members attempted to intervene. The cabin crew then informed passengers over the intercom that the pilots made the decision to divert the plane. The four passengers involved in the flight were escorted off the plane and arrested at Pisa city airport. Ryanair has reportedly said in reaction to the incident that it will not tolerate such behavior on their flights and that the security of their staff and passengers is a priority.
